A Call to Action for Swift and Effective Aid
DiCaprio’s donation will go directly to organizations dedicated to the immediate and post-fire recovery process. His support of Rewild’s Rapid Response Program will direct the dollars to critical organizations like the California Fire Foundation, the Los Angeles Fire Department Foundation, and World Central Kitchen. These businesses are crucial in providing emergency relief, distributing supplies, and ensuring that survivors have access to food, shelter, and essential services. The Rewild Rapid Response Program has built a reputation for surprising and effectively addressing environmental catastrophes, ensuring resources are deployed where they are needed most.
